HCM Retirement Defender 100 Index ETF (LGH) and Goldman Sachs MarketBeta U.S. Equity ETF (GSUS) belong to the same industry segment: US Large Cap. Both ETFs have the same top 3 sector exposures: Information Technology,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ary. LGH is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 1%, versus 0.09% for GSUS. LGH is down -2.31% year-to-date (YTD) with -$3M in YTD flows. GSUS performs better with -1.08% YTD performance, and -$10M in YTD flows.
